St. Joseph’s Church in Greenwich Village is opening a chapel for Perpetual Adoration of the Eucharist in the heart of New York City.

His Eminence Cardinal Timothy Dolan will dedicate the chapel during a special Mass on July 30.

The Good Newsroom stopped by for an exclusive preview ahead of the official opening.
